Beyond Retribution

Justice is often portrayed as a swift and punishing force, meting out repercussions for transgressions. Yet, the true nature of justice extends far beyond mere retaliation. While holding culprits accountable is crucial, a truly just system must also prioritize restoration. This involves addressing the root causes of misconduct, and creating possibilities for growth.

By focusing solely on discipline, we risk perpetuating a cycle of pain. True justice requires a more holistic approach, one that seeks to mend the tapestry of society and empower individuals to prosper.

This shift in perspective requires a willingness to understanding, recognizing that even those who have {caused{ harm are capable of growth. It is through this lens of forgiveness that we can truly move beyond retribution and build a more just and equitable world.
